Why Do Dogs’ Bites Inflict Excruciating Pain?

Dog bites can cause excruciating pain due to several factors, including the anatomy of a dog’s mouth, their jaw structure and strength, and the specific mechanisms that come into play during a bite. Understanding these factors can help shed light on why dog bites can be so painful and provide insights into managing bite pain effectively.

Understanding the Anatomy of a Dog’s Bite

To comprehend the intensity of pain caused by a dog bite, it is essential to understand the anatomy of a dog’s mouth. Dogs have sharp, pointed teeth that are designed for puncturing and tearing. Their mouths also contain a large number of bacteria, which can lead to infection and exacerbate pain. Additionally, dogs have powerful jaw muscles that allow them to exert significant biting force, resulting in deeper and more severe wounds.

Analyzing the Dog’s Jaw Structure and Strength

A major contributing factor to the intensity of pain inflicted by dog bites lies in the structure and strength of a dog’s jaw. Dogs have a unique jaw structure that enables them to generate immense pressure. The mandibles, or lower jaws, of dogs are notably strong and dense, with muscles and tendons that provide stability and power. This allows dogs to exert tremendous force when biting, which can lead to severe tissue damage and intense pain.

How Does a Dog’s Bite Force Compare to Humans?

When comparing a dog’s bite force to that of humans, the difference is striking. While a human typically exerts a bite force of around 120 to 200 pounds per square inch (psi), certain dog breeds can deliver a bite force of up to 700 psi or even higher. This immense bite force, combined with the sharpness of a dog’s teeth, can result in deep tissue penetration, causing severe pain and potential long-term consequences.

Unraveling the Mechanisms behind Painful Dog Bites

Several mechanisms contribute to the intense pain experienced from dog bites. One crucial factor is the pressure applied during the bite, which compresses tissues, damages nerves, and disrupts blood vessels, leading to significant pain. Additionally, the tearing motion of a dog’s teeth as they pull away from the bite can cause further damage to tissues, increasing the pain sensation.

Exploring the Nerve Endings Involved in Bite Pain

Pain from dog bites is also attributed to the extensive presence of nerve endings in the affected area. These nerve endings, known as nociceptors, are highly sensitive to pain stimuli. When bitten, these nociceptors are stimulated, sending pain signals to the brain. The abundance of nerve endings in the skin, muscles, and tissues surrounding the bite area amplifies the pain experienced.

The Biochemical Reactions Triggered by Dog Bites

Dog bites trigger biochemical reactions within the body that contribute to the intense pain. When bitten, the body releases a cascade of chemical mediators, such as histamines and prostaglandins, which signal inflammation and pain. These biochemical reactions heighten the pain sensation and can lead to localized redness, swelling, and warmth.

The Psychological Factors that Worsen Bite Pain

Psychological factors can also exacerbate the pain experienced from a dog bite. Fear, anxiety, and stress can amplify pain perception, making it feel even more intense. The emotional distress associated with being bitten by a dog, especially if it was unexpected or traumatic, can make the pain more distressing and difficult to manage.

Why Do Some Dog Bites Hurt More Than Others?

Not all dog bites are created equal, and the severity of pain can vary based on several factors. The size and breed of the dog, the location and depth of the bite, and the individual’s pain tolerance all play a role in determining the level of pain experienced. Larger dogs and deep bites are more likely to cause severe pain, while individual pain thresholds can influence the subjective perception of pain.

The Role of Inflammation in Amplifying Bite Pain

Inflammation is a significant contributor to the intense pain caused by dog bites. When tissue is damaged, the body initiates an inflammatory response to facilitate healing. However, this inflammation can also contribute to pain. The release of chemical mediators during the inflammatory process sensitizes nerve endings and increases pain perception. Managing inflammation through appropriate wound care and medical intervention can help alleviate the pain associated with dog bites.

Factors That Can Aggravate the Pain from Dog Bites

Several additional factors can aggravate the pain experienced from dog bites. Infection, which often accompanies dog bites due to bacteria in a dog’s mouth, can worsen pain. Delayed or inadequate wound care can lead to increased pain and complications. Pre-existing health conditions, such as diabetes or impaired immune function, can also contribute to heightened pain sensitivity and delayed healing.

Effective Strategies for Managing Bite Pain

To effectively manage pain from dog bites, a comprehensive approach is necessary. Immediate wound care, including cleaning the wound and applying appropriate dressings, can help minimize pain and reduce the risk of infection. Pain medications may be prescribed by a healthcare professional to alleviate pain. Additionally, psychological support, such as counseling or therapy, can aid in coping with the emotional distress associated with a dog bite. Regular follow-up with medical professionals ensures proper wound healing and pain management.
